Spokesman restates Buhari’s commitment to good governance
President Muhammadu Buhari is to keep working for the progress of the country, with a focus on leaving behind stronger democratic institutions and culture to drive development, his Special Adviser (Media and Publicity), Femi Adesina, has reiterated.
The presidential aide gave the reassurance yesterday in Abuja while receiving an award from the Progressive Councilors Forum (PCF), an association of past and present councilors, led by the chairman, Sunday Yusuf Achor.
The spokesman said his principal remained committed to enthroning a greater Nigeria, delivering democracy dividends to the citizens and working with organisations, especially those directly involved with the grassroots, to promote good governance.
Adesina assured the PCF of the administration’s continued disposition to partnerships that could sell the policies and programmes of the Buhari government to Nigerians.
